Updated 47m agoRamp projects $1.4 billion ARR as it gears up for IPO
Fintech startup Ramp says it will reach a $1.4 billion annual recurring revenue run rate this quarter, up from the $1 billion reported in September. The company cites a 70% year‑over‑year increase in its customer base and expects about $125 million in free cash flow for the year.

Electric Propulsion Innovator Arc Raises $50M in New Funding
Arc, a Los Angeles‑based electric boat and powertrain firm, closed a $50 million Series C round led by investors such as a16z, Menlo Ventures, and Eclipse. The capital will be used to accelerate production of electric tugboat powertrains and to expand the company’s portfolio into ferries and defense vessels. Arc’s first electric tug is slated for delivery this year, with a second already under construction and further deployments planned nationwide. The company highlights its vertically integrated hardware‑software model as a catalyst for performance, reliability, and reduced maintenance.

Exclusive: Exponent Energy Raising $20 Mn in an Extended Series B
Exponent Energy announced an extended Series B round that will raise Rs 182 crore ($20 million), co‑led by 360 One and TDK Ventures, with participation from existing backers. Venture Capitalists Eye Indirect Paths to SpaceX Ahead of Expected $50B IPO
With SpaceX poised for a potential $50 billion IPO, venture investors are turning to indirect vehicles—Alphabet stock, ARK’s ARK Venture Fund, and private‑market platforms—to capture upside. The strategy reflects a broader shift toward private‑market exposure as high‑growth unicorns stay private longer.

AI Startups Command 41% of 2025 Venture Capital, Raising $52.5 B
AI‑focused startups captured $52.5 billion, or 41% of the $128 billion venture‑capital dollars deployed in 2025, delivering the strongest returns among sectors. The shift is prompting limited partners to re‑evaluate allocations and general partners to adjust fund strategies.

Earendil Labs Announces $787M in Financing
Earendil Labs, an AI‑driven biotechnology firm, announced a $787 million financing round. The capital came from a consortium that includes Dimension Capital, DST Global, Sanofi, and a Pfizer‑Hillhouse biotech fund. UK Tech Funding Roundup: This Week’s Deals From Edra to First Concepts
UK venture capital tracked £53.69 million across six deals from 16‑20 March, a 97% week‑on‑week drop. The largest round was Edra’s £22.4 million Series A for AI‑driven workflow automation, followed by Tracebit’s £15 million Series A in cloud‑focused cybersecurity.
